ELK Stack (Elasticsearch, Logstash, Kibana) הוא כלי ניתוח יומנים חיוני במערכות מודרניות. במאמר זה, נסביר מהו ELK Stack ולמה הוא חשוב. נדגיש את החשיבות והיתרונות של ניתוח יומנים, ונפרט את תהליך ניתוח היומנים באמצעות ELK Stack שלב אחר שלב. נרחיב על תפקידי רכיבי Elasticsearch, Logstash ו-Kibana, ונציע טיפים לניתוח יומנים מהיר. בנוסף, נדון ביישומי ELK Stack, פרויקטים לדוגמה ושיטות עבודה מומלצות. נדבר על יתרונות וחסרונות, ונציין טעויות נפוצות ופתרונות. לבסוף, נסיים את המאמר עם המלצות לשימוש ב-ELK Stack.
מהו ELK Stack ולמה הוא חשוב?
ELK Stack הוא פלטפורמת ניהול, ניתוח והדמיה של יומנים המורכבת משלושה כלים קוד פתוח: Elasticsearch, Logstash ו-Kibana. שלישייה זו מציעה פתרון בלתי נמנע לארגונים המעוניינים להפיק תובנות חשובות מנתוני ענק. בעידן שבו מורכבות המערכות והיישומים גוברת, ניהול וניתוח נתוני יומנים בצורה אפקטיבית חשובים מתמיד. בשלב זה נכנס לתמונה ELK Stack, המפשט ומאיץ את תהליכי ניתוח הנתונים.
אחת הסיבות המרכזיות לפופולריות של ELK Stack היא גמישותו ויכולת הסקלה שלו. הוא יכול לעבד, לנתח ולהדמיה נתונים ממקורות שונים בקלות. בנוסף, כאמור הוא קוד פתוח, מה שמאפשר למשתמשים להתאים ולפתח אותו על פי צרכיהם. זה הופך את ELK Stack ליישום שימושי, החל מפרויקטים קטנים ועד לפתרונות ארגוניים גדולים.
רכיבי ELK Stack העיקריים
- Elasticsearch: מנוע החיפוש שבו מאוחסנים ומדודים הנתונים.
- Logstash: אוסף ומעבד נתונים ממקורות שונים ושולח אותם ל-Elasticsearch.
- Kibana: ממשק המשמש להדמיה ולניתוח הנתונים ב-Elasticsearch.
- Beats: סוכנים קלים לאיסוף נתונים ממקורות שונים ושולחים אותם ל-Logstash או ל-Elasticsearch.
ELK Stack הוא כלי חיוני במיוחד עבור DevOps ומנהלי מערכות. הוא משמש בתחומים רבים, כגון ניטור ביצועי מערכות, זיהוי תקלות ותגובה לאירועי אבטחה. איסוף וניתוח נתוני יומנים במקום מרכזי מסייע בפתרון בעיות במהירות רבה יותר ובשיפור האבטחה של המערכות. בנוסף, הוא מספק נתונים חשובים ליישומי בינה עסקית וניתוח, ובכך משפר את תהליכי קבלת ההחלטות.
השוואת רכיבי ELK Stack
| רכיב | תיאור | פונקציות עיקריות |
|---|---|---|
| Elasticsearch | מנוע חיפוש וניתוח מבוזר | אחסון נתונים, אינדוקס, חיפוש |
| Logstash | כלי לאיסוף ועיבוד נתונים | איסוף נתונים, סינון, המרה |
| Kibana | פלטפורמת הדמיה של נתונים | יצירת לוח בקרה, ניתוח נתונים, דיווח חזותי |
| Beats | שולחי נתונים קלים | איסוף נתונים, שליחת נתונים ל-Elasticsearch |
ELK Stack הוא פתרון חזק, גמיש וניתן להרחבה לניתוח נתונים מודרני וניהול יומנים. ככל שמורכבות המערכות והיישומים גוברת, כך גובר הצורך בכלים מסוג זה. באמצעות ELK Stack, ארגונים יכולים לשפר את היעילות התפעולית שלהם, לחזק את האבטחה ולקבל החלטות מושכלות יותר.
חשיבות ניתוח היומנים ויתרונותיו

ניתוח יומנים הוא בעל חשיבות קריטית להבטחת פעילות בריאה ובטוחה של תשתיות ויישומים מודרניים. הנתונים היומיים (יומנים) המופקים על ידי מערכות, יישומים ומכשירים רשתיים מסייעים בזיהוי בעיות פוטנציאליות, אופטימיזציה של ביצועים ו...